A friend just sold one after her husband passed. I think she was asking $1400-$1500. She included half a dozen tool rests and a Nova chuck.

Generally 50% of new is a good starting point, however you don’t mention the age, any accessories you may include, have you had to replace any parts or electronics. Now with all that said, if inventory levels are low right now you may be able to get something of a minor premium.
